Title: Michael Vagedes: Innovator in Custom Shutters and Vent Panels
Introduction
Michael Vagedes is a notable inventor based in Florence, KY (US). He has made significant contributions to the field of building products, holding a total of 16 patents. His innovative designs focus on enhancing functionality and aesthetics in construction materials.
Latest Patents
Among his latest inventions is the Custom Shutter, which features a central body portion with first and second end caps. The design includes two stiles and a central portion, all formed integrally as one piece. The end caps are crafted to ensure a seamless fit, covering any exposed edges of the shutter body. Another notable patent is the Injection Moldable Composite Gable Vent. This vent is designed with panels that can be formed through injection molding or vacuum forming. The innovative design allows for easy assembly and customization, making it a versatile solution for various building needs.
